Ronald Walkup, 72, of Warr Acres, went home to be with the Lord on Tuesday, December 6, 2022. He was born to Roy J. and Helene W. Walkup (Lieman) on August 31, 1950 in Markt Schwaben, Germany. At a young age, his family migrated to the United States where they lived in various states due to his father's service in the Air Force. When Ron was 15, they moved to a farm in Olney, OK, where he helped his father raise cattle. After graduating from Olney High School, he enlisted in the United States Air Force on August 22, 1968, where he served as a jet engine mechanic and a sergeant until he was honorably discharged on October 9, 1971. After his service, he held different occupations before finding his favorite career as a delivery truck driver. In 1989 Ron met the love of his life, Vonda, and they were married the same year. In 2011, he began his work for the State of Oklahoma as an Interagency Mailman for the Office of Management and Enterprise Services; he enjoyed this position for 9 years, retiring in 2020. He enjoyed reading, fishing, traveling, and watching baseball as well as his favorite team, OSU football. Ron is preceded in death by his parents, 2 siblings, Peter Ruder and Hannah Thisse, and many other family members. He is survived by his wife of 33 years, Vonda Walkup (Penner) of Warr Acres, OK; their three daughters, Katie Lynn and husband Brian Lee Boutwell of Bethany, OK, Michele Ann Walker of Oklahoma City, OK, and Mary Helene Walkup of Warr Acres, OK, and one son, Jacob Roy Walkup and wife Danni Angel; two grandsons, Matthew Logan Boutwell and Isaac Lee Boutwell; and many other extended family and friends. Ron was a dedicated and beloved husband, father, grandfather, and friend; he was loved and will be missed dearly.
